The Importance of Accurate Banking Codes
Danske Bank A/S, headquartered at Storetorv 5 in Aabenraa, Denmark's Syddanmark region, requires the precise SWIFT/BIC code DABADKKKAAB for international transfers. This identifier facilitates seamless interbank transactions across borders.
SWIFT codes play an indispensable role in global banking operations. Every international transfer depends on these codes to identify both the recipient bank and its location. Verifying the correct SWIFT code for the beneficiary's bank before initiating a transfer remains essential to prevent delays and financial complications.
